Social Media & Content Manager

Percival, London Studio, Hackney Wick

About Percival

Percival is a London menswear brand known for a distinctive point of view, considered design and a strong and engaged following. The business operates from a studio in London with a small, closely collaborative team, where individual ownership is high and decisions are made quickly alongside long range planning.

The role

Percival is looking for a Social Media & Content Manager to take ownership of the brand's organic social channels, with the emphasis firmly on making content as well as scheduling it. We want someone who can take the channels and run with them, shooting and editing social-first video to the standard the brand expects, and doing it in a way that feels unmistakably Percival. The seasonal and campaign work is produced by the wider team and this role contributes to it, but the day-to-day rhythm of the channels is yours to own. Alongside the main Percival accounts, the role also looks after PCVL and supports the founder's channel.

Key responsibilities

Content creation

  • Produce the baseline organic content that keeps Percival's channels consistently active, shooting and editing social-first video in the studio, on set and on location
  • Write and shape the content, from hooks and scripts through to storyboarding social video before it is shot
  • Contribute to campaign and seasonal shoots led by the wider team, capturing social-specific material on the day and adapting existing assets for social afterwards
  • Develop content that brings the audience closer to the product and the people behind it, including the design process, the studio, the supply chain and the manufacturing behind each collection
  • Sit in creative and content meetings from the outset, so social is considered alongside the main campaign rather than after it

Channel management

  • Own the organic content plan and publishing schedule across Instagram and TikTok, from concept through to publication
  • Run Stories daily, both planned and reactive, covering behind the scenes, product pushes, reshares and anything worth jumping on that week
  • Grow PCVL as a channel in its own right, planning and producing its content and helping shape a distinct identity for it as it scales
  • Support the founder's channel, developing ideas and formats, filming with him regularly and helping bring the founder and studio side of Percival to the audience
  • Maintain a consistent brand voice and visual standard across everything published
  • Identify emerging platform trends and formats, and judge their relevance to Percival before adopting them

Design and assets

  • Create and artwork the assets needed for social posting, including adding text, resizing and building simple assets from scratch
  • Work closely with our in-house Graphic Designer on everything beyond that, briefing clearly and early, particularly around launches, promotions and sales

Community management

  • Act as the brand's voice within the community, responding to comments and direct messages in a timely and appropriate manner
  • Monitor sentiment and conversation across channels and escalate issues where necessary

Creators and influencers

  • Work with the Head of Marketing on creator and influencer activity, bringing ideas and names to the table and supporting content from brief through to delivery
  • Keep a live view of the creators, talent and accounts worth knowing, and a clear sense of who fits the brand and who does not

Supporting wider marketing activity

  • Supply organic content to the paid media, email and on-site teams

Reporting

  • Track channel and content performance against agreed measures and present findings and recommendations to the wider marketing team on a regular basis. Support on commercial interpretation will be provided by the Head of Marketing

Candidate profile

Essential

  • Demonstrable experience shooting and editing social-first video to a high standard, evidenced by a portfolio, showreel or active social account
  • The ability to take an idea from concept through writing, shooting and editing to publication, working at pace and to deadline
  • Strong working knowledge of Instagram and TikTok, including current formats, conventions and audience behaviour
  • Confidence creating and artworking social assets, and briefing a designer for anything beyond that
  • Sound editorial judgement, with the ability to tell the difference between content that is simply popular and content that is right for the brand
  • A genuine feel for brand, and the appetite to own a channel rather than execute against someone else's plan
  • Experience of, or a clear aptitude for, community management
  • A working knowledge of the creator and influencer landscape
  • Confidence discussing content performance and a willingness to develop commercial understanding

Desirable

  • Experience within fashion, menswear or a comparable consumer brand
  • Experience working directly with creators or influencers
  • Familiarity with how organic content is used within paid social activity
  • Photography or design skills alongside video

How the team works

Percival operates a small and fluid team where job titles are held loosely. The successful candidate will be given considerable ownership at an early stage and will be involved in work that can extend beyond the boundaries of this description.

Working pattern

Social media does not align neatly to standard office hours. Content opportunities and community activity arise during evenings and at weekends, particularly around shoots, events and product launches, and the role requires someone comfortable working in this way. Percival operates flexibly in return and supports time taken back accordingly.

Terms

  • Reports to: Head of Marketing
  • Location: Hackney Wick, London
  • Contract: Full Time

Benefits:

  • Access to a free gym
  • Quarterly clothing allowance
  • 33 days annual leave for full time employees (25 days holiday + 8 bank holidays)
  • Pension Scheme
  • Cycle to Work Scheme
  • Employee Assistance Programme (EAP)
  • Regular socials, karaoke skills beneficial but not required
  • Competitive Salary

Application

Applications should include a CV and cover letter together with a portfolio, showreel or links to relevant work. Candidates are encouraged to submit examples of video content they have personally shot and edited, as this will form a central part of the assessment.
